Anita Roach is a scholar working on Immunology and Allergy, Experimental and Cognitive Psychology and General Health Professions. According to data from OpenAlex, Anita Roach has authored 12 papers receiving a total of 279 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 5 papers in Immunology and Allergy, 4 papers in Experimental and Cognitive Psychology and 3 papers in General Health Professions. Recurrent topics in Anita Roach's work include Food Allergy and Anaphylaxis Research (5 papers), Sleep and related disorders (4 papers) and Sleep and Work-Related Fatigue (3 papers). Anita Roach is often cited by papers focused on Food Allergy and Anaphylaxis Research (5 papers), Sleep and related disorders (4 papers) and Sleep and Work-Related Fatigue (3 papers). Anita Roach collaborates with scholars based in United States, Italy and France. Anita Roach's co-authors include Max Hirshkowitz, Michael J. Paskow, D. Sunshine Hillygus, Kristen L. Knutson, Kenneth L. Lichstein, Terri E. Weaver, William A. Broughton, Julie E. Phelan, Sudhansu Chokroverty and Ruchi S. Gupta and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Allergy and Clinical Immunology, SLEEP and Arthritis & Rheumatology.
